Output 628385bf61f626edeac9d7d011b69c48b4a22268b7a24d574b9cd859ab264c3a:1

value
108816481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a9b43b98d59ad69a52b274325133b677b8be8a1 OP_EQUAL
address
39x6jn7K53LQmRKSfsue7y9eG7oU97YKRS
transaction
628385bf61f626edeac9d7d011b69c48b4a22268b7a24d574b9cd859ab264c3a
spent
true